This aluminium saver kit upgrades the stock plastic servo saver and tie rods on the TAMIYA CW-01 Lunch Box chassis with machined metal components intended to improve durability and steering feel. The assembly pairs a 25T high-torque saver with aluminium tie rods to reduce flex and wear where plastic parts may fail.
Compatibility targets the CW-01 (Lunch Box) chassis and requires servos with a 25T spline for correct engagement. The part functions as the mechanical interface between the servo output and steering linkage, protecting internal servo gearing while maintaining steering precision.
Installation: remove the original saver and tie rods, reuse any appropriate hardware, then mount the aluminium saver on the servo spline. Check spline engagement, steering travel, and tie rod geometry to ensure no binding. There are no electronic modifications needed for fitment.
Maintenance: metal parts lower elasticity compared with stock items but still need periodic inspection for thread tightness and alignment. Use thread-lock on metal-to-metal fasteners where recommended and inspect after impacts. The tie rods provide a consistent baseline for steering trim and toe adjustments.
